## Authentication

Deploybeak, the Harkwell deploy-status bot, requires every plugin to authenticate against the internal status relay before posting channel updates. Requests without valid credentials are silently dropped, so verify your setup with the /ping command first. Tokens are scoped per plugin and rotate quarterly. Configure your plugin with the relay key shown below.

gateway credential: kto23_LX9A4ys6i4nzHtpOLNLodKK

## Further Reading

The Lattermill N+1 fix introduced request-scoped batching for all resolver-level lookups, which changes query volume characteristics between releases. Before approving a rollout, please review the batching design notes, the benchmark comparisons against the pre-fix baseline, and the known edge cases around nested pagination. All of this material is collected on the following internal page.

wiki page, tahaf-tajog: https://jira.ordindyn.corp/pipeline

Runbook: Ticket-pricing experiment (Farrowgate)

Scope: dynamic pricing test on the Bramblefest event pages only. Do not touch production price tables.

1. Enable the `fare_trial_b` flag in staging.
2. Run the Quillet smoke suite.
3. Compare checkout totals against the control snapshot.
4. Flag any drift over 1% to the Farrowgate lead.

Log the trace value shown below with your results.

build token for kagaf-hahof: htk14_9d3d4d26d7d8de

## Thumbnail Generation Queue

The Plinkery media service enqueues thumbnail jobs onto the Corvax queue whenever an upload lands. Workers pull jobs, render three sizes, and write results to the Hatchmere store. Reviewers should check that failed renders requeue at most twice before parking. Workers authenticate to Corvax with a shared internal key, set via environment at deploy. That key is listed below.

gateway credential: kto7_GoY89Me

Runbook: Meridian API circuit breaker

When the upstream Meridian quote API degrades, the Torrin gateway trips its circuit breaker and serves cached responses. Verify trip events against gateway logs before resetting; premature resets can mask credential failures. The breaker's thresholds and timeout behavior are controlled entirely by the configuration below.

settings of fafog-haduf:
ZORIX_PIN=4648
ZORIX_METRICS_HOST=metrics.zorix.paliqsys.corp
ZORIX_LOG_LEVEL=info
ZORIX_TENANT=druix